Q: Is 311,765 a Prime Number?
A: No, 311,765 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 311765 can be evenly divided by 1 5 23 115 2,711 13,555 62,353 and 311,765, with no remainder.
Since 311,765 cannot be divided by just 1 and 311,765, it is not a prime number.
